Cambridge International General Secondary Education Certificate (IGCSE)

It is one of the most recognized certificates worldwide. The Cambridge IGCSE program is a learning process aimed at problem solving, including remembering information and verbal skills. It integrates all vital educational skills, including teamwork and research skills. The acquisitions gained at the end of all these processes prepare the student for higher education programs such as Cambridge AS / A Level, Abitur, IB Diploma, Advanced International Certificate.

The IGCSE program consists of "Basic Curriculum" CORE (standard level) and "Extended Program" EXTENDED (advanced level) programs that target different skill levels in many different subjects. In the second term of the 10th grade, students take the exam that is suitable for their level with the direction of the course teacher.

TED – Canada Student Exchange Program

Within the scope of the Canadian Education Agreement signed between the Turkish Education Association and the Government of Canada, all TED School students have the right to attend the intercultural student exchange program and receive their equivalence, to continue their education at TED Schools again and to receive a double diploma.

Program; It aims to provide students with good English and the opportunity to study university abroad, while creating opportunities for students, their families and host families to deepen understanding and respect for different cultures and discover the realities of humanity.

The International Baccalaureate Diploma Program (UBDP)

Teaching in TED Schools is an organic process that is individualized according to the student, shaped in line with the needs, supported and monitored by teacher guidance and technology. The process includes curricula created by differentiating products and content, national and international values, scales and standards. The main purpose of universally valid IB programs is to raise individuals with an international understanding. International monitoring and authorization of the practices supports the self-assessment process of the institution and the practices are constantly updated.

In addition to the diploma given by the Ministry of National Education in our country, UBDP, which provides students with an internationally recognized diploma, is an adaptable program that allows changes according to the educational needs of the countries where it is applied and is officially recognized by the Ministry of National Education.

UBDP, besides its academic success, students; It aims to raise self-discipline, acquire high-level thinking skills, adopt continuous learning as a way of life, be conscious of their social responsibilities, know and understand different cultures, and be raised as “citizens of the world”. Students participating in UBDP, which is the symbol of academic credibility and intellectual thought, are proudly accepted by distinguished universities around the world and the best universities of our country.

Successful students who graduate from this program, which requires a broad and fairly intensive study, college entrance examination in addition to achieving success diploma degrees according to the best universities in scholarship right to read and loans around the world and in Turkey (course exemption) they win. T.R. The government does not allow applications to domestic universities with only the UB diploma. However, the universities abroad, there is the possibility of application and acceptance into the university entrance exams in Turkey.

The Advanced Placement (AP))

The Advanced Placement (AP) program, also known as the Advanced Placement Program, is a powerful, comprehensive and hard-working program that is implemented in the United States of America (USA) and spread from there to the whole world, aiming for excellence in education. AP Program is implemented and recognized in more than 60 countries outside of the USA.

The AP Program provides students with the opportunity to take university-level courses while in high school and to be exempt from these courses at the university. Especially in the acceptance phase of the students abroad university applications, the fact that a student has taken AP courses and successfully passed the exams during high school is considered as an indicator of their readiness for academic education.

Students who take AP courses and pass the exams are more advantageous than students who apply to universities in the standard application process, and also have the chance to be exempt from these courses when they start university. In addition, they can study more easily in double major programs.

Educational Excellence (BTEC)

BTEC, which is carried out with more than 4 million students in 110 countries around the world, is applied only in TED Schools in our country. BTEC program, which stands for educational excellence and accepted by Edexcel, the largest accreditation institution in England in transition to universities abroad, is a practice-oriented, practical and vibrant education model that aims to provide students with professional competencies.

With BTEC programs, it is aimed to equip students with the skills necessary for entering higher education, to gain competencies related to the professions they dream of, and to make them preferred individuals for the leading companies of the sector. This program, which is accepted by European, USA, Asian and Australian universities and companies around the world, has been continuously developed and renewed and designed in accordance with the needs of the learner, employer and the age.

In addition to having an internationally valid certificate, students who have completed the program have the opportunity to directly admit to the undergraduate (HND) program in England.

Scientist Training Program (BİYP)

Aiming to raise students who have made scientific thinking a way of life, the application and research-oriented "Scientist Training Program" enriched the education and training activities of students with high academic performance, based on research, application and productivity; It is a four-year program consisting of two departments, Science and Social Sciences, in which it is trained with an understanding of learning based on school-university cooperation.

Science and a researcher spirit in the field of Social Sciences, productive, assimilate scientific thought and these features have made a lifestyle of students who aims to educate "Scientist Training Program" with the Board of Education's approval is applied for the first time at TED schools in Turkey.

The "Scientist Training Program" is based on research, practice and productivity, enriching the education and training studies of students with high academic performance; It is a four-year program consisting of two departments, Science and Social Sciences, in which it is trained with an understanding of learning based on school-university cooperation. In the Scientist Training Program, Physics, Chemistry, Biology and Mathematics lessons are taught in English as in our other programs.

Students who graduate from the Science Department of the program have the same rights as the students who graduated from the Science Department of the National High School Program during the university entrance exams, and the students who graduated from the Social Sciences department of the National High School Program have the same rights as the students who graduated from the Turkish-Mathematics Department of the National High School Program.
